I've read that in the case of polite plurals (using "vy" when addressing one person), one should use "jste" in plural, but the past verb should be in singular. However, when I wrote, "Jel jste tam devátého?" I was told that the correct answer is "jeli jste." Is that really the right answer for both regular plural and the polite plural?

No, you were correct. "Jel jste" should be accepted.

In this case there are so many accepted variations that it is very easy to miss something. Corrected.

